scripts: add sed expression to apply when renumbering patches

Some patchsets have superfluous members in their names (eg. the ones coming
from Gentoo), so it can come in handy to pass a sed RE to strip them out of
the final patch name.
Also add a 'fake' mode, where the command will only be printed and not
executed, so we can check beforehand if the rename will be OK.
